Here I go: I’m going to run a marathon (gulp)
“Why on EARTH would you do that to yourself?”
I’d just cheered on my sister in her first marathon some years back and this was what I was thinking. I had no concept of what 42.2k meant (other than freakin’ long), I just knew she’d been running for more than four hours. FOUR HOURS. Hence my “Why oh why????” I mean, sure she looked happy, but lots of things make me happy–like sleeping an extra four hours.
And here I am in 2012 planning to run my first marathon.
See, since then, I’ve somehow become a runner (check out what I get from running here on my post at The Kit). And I’ve got nine half-marathons and one 30k race under my belt (that’s my pile of medals above) and I need a new challenge. And short of running a half even faster (which would call for killer speed training), I’d rather double the distance — so I think that means I’m only somewhat a glutton for punishment? Or maybe I’m just crazy, like that blogger chick on the current season of The Bachelor.
Wish me luck. Training will be hard.
